Abstract:
This thesis presents an implementation of process management for a security kernel based secure archival storage system SASS. The implementation is based on a family of secure, distributed, multi-microprocessor operating systems designed to provide multilevel internal security and controlled sharing of data among authorized users. Process scheduling is effected by one half of a two level Traffic Controller that binds processes to virtualized processors. Inter-process communication mechanisms for synchronization, mutual exclusion, and message passing among processes are provided by utilization of eventcount and sequencer primitives. The implementation structure is based upon levels of abstraction and is loop free to permit future expansion to more complex members to the design family. Implementation was completed on the ADVANCED MICRO COMPUTERS Am 964116 AmZ8002 16 Bit Monoboard Computer.
